“If someone knocks the other one out, they’re gonna get a big, big bonus,” Paul said, making it clear that this fight won’t be just another exhibition. The bout, scheduled for November 14 at the Kaseya Center in Miami, will be fought with 12-ounce gloves and has already sparked debate due to the huge weight difference: Paul could weigh in at 195 pounds, while Davis, the WBA lightweight champion, typically fights around 135.
